The pendulum consists of a slender 2-kg rod AB and 5-kg disk. It is released from rest without rotating. When it falls 0.3 m, the end A strikes the hook S, which provides a permanent connection. Determine the angular velocity of the pendulum after it has rotated \(90^{\circ}\). Treat the pendulum’s weight during impact as a nonimpulsive force.
